Q&A With Malte Niebelschuetz, Founder & CEO of Shore Buddies

0

1. Tell us a bit about Shore Buddies.

Shore Buddies are environmentally friendly stuffed animals. They are made from recycled plastic bottles and $1 with every purchase is donated to Ocean Protection ($1 for the Ocean)

2. What gave you the idea for your business and how did it start?

I read an article about Patagonia and how they changed their sourcing to all sustainable material. I read about one outdoor jacket that was made from recycled soda pop bottles. Living in San Diego, I was thinking about a sustainable souvenir with a similar concept. Since the material for a stuffed animal and clothing is very similar, and after finding manufacturing, Shore Buddies was born.
